Abstract
This paper seeks to examine the impact of various factors like the number of startup procedures, the time required to get an electricity connection, availability of internet servers, judicial processes, lending rate, percentage of young population, corporate tax, and land administration processes on the number of MSMEs (per ten thousand inhabitants) in a country. We aim to develop a linear regression model showing the effect of the above-stated factors on the number of MSMEs. The results show that there is a relationship between all the independent variables and the dependent variable, excluding 2 independent variables which were dropped from the model. There was a positive relationship between the dependent variable which is the number of MSMEs, and the independent variables Internet servers, and land administration processes. There was a negative relationship of the dependent variable with the independent variables - number of Startup procedures, days required to get an electric connection, lending rate, and corporate tax.
